Cresarrow, established by Henry Blank in the late 1800s, entered into contracts with prestigious watchmakers such as Patek Philippe, Vacheron & Constantin, and Tiffany & Co. to craft wristwatch cases specifically for the U.S. market. In addition to cases, Cresarrow also provided movements for Tiffany and Cartier watches. Interestingly, there is evidence suggesting that Cresarrow collaborated with C.H. Meylan, a Swiss manufacturer known for high-quality timepieces, as well as IWC Schaffhausen, for the production of their watch movements.
